Map of Collingtree, England, home of Samuel Cockerill (1793-d. bef. 1881) & Mary Longstaff (b. 1794) & Jabez Cockerill (b.1823) & Susannah Beech (1823-1899)
Map of Collingtree, England, home of the Samuel and Mary Longstaff Cockerill family, came from Clifton “Gayle” Cockerill’s website “Samuel Cockerill Genealogy” at http://olypen.com/cliffc/genealogy/index.html Note from Clifton "Gayle" Cockerill: Collingtree, England, which is a suburb of Northampton, is about 60 miles north of London on Hwy M1. Notice that Wootton, which is the home and/or birth place of several of the Cockerill family, is located northeast of Collingtree.

Source:
Donna Forney Clark:
James C. Cockerill (1846-1921) immigrated into Sarpy, NE, USA 1871. He was followed by three brothers in 1872: George Cockerill (b. 1852); William Cockerill (b. 1844); & [John] Joseph ( 1842-1918) & Catherine Elizabeth Hunt Cockerill (1849-1930) & their infant son Joseph James Cockerill (1871-1955).
